Florida’s Lemon Law protects consumers who purchase or lease new vehicles with serious defects that can't be fixed after multiple attempts. If the defect affects the car’s use, value, or safety, you may be entitled to a refund, replacement, or compensation.

Breach of warranty means the seller or manufacturer didn’t honor promises made about the product. In cars, that can include:
Florida recognizes express and implied warranties—each has different legal protections.
